Hey that's pretty slick!

I have a Subaru I'm probably going to do something real similar with now that the MS2 code works.

That ECU looks about the same as my 97/98 2.2 Impreza's, so I'm assuming this is a MAF based engine? I thought they changed the ECU when they went speed density.

I'm very interested in the details if it's a MAF arrangement. I was thinking I'd like to keep the ability to swap back to my stock ECU in a pinch while I'm playing with various ideas and expanding beyond MS.

We are just ignoring the MAF and ran a MAP line. There is also no IAT sensor on these cars so we ran an extra wire out of the MS and added a GM IAT to the airbox.
